Transaction bbab20033f16a087d60a765e5cbfe7b6bf723ad2bf9bc57e7eaa93f29a23c6da
1 Input
1 Outputs
- bbab20033f16a087d60a765e5cbfe7b6bf723ad2bf9bc57e7eaa93f29a23c6da:0
value 22242472
address 1CXYtCEwYSnwJiowxxUp8szAst4AmKcHD5